On Tue, Jun 27, 2006 at 02:24:55PM -0700, Safeer Jiwan wrote:
> Hello all,
> I'm interested to know if anyone has attempted to run Condor on a Mac
> OS X Intel system.
>
> The documentation does state that "Given MacOS's support for running
> PPC binaries in emulation (their ``Rosetta'' system), the existing
> Condor binaries built for PPC MacOS 10.3 might work."
>
> Details of any issues you've had as well as any performance loss
> would be appreciated.
It mostly works, and whatever slowdown Rosetta adds isn't really noticable,
Condor isn't CPU-intensive.
The one thing that doesnt work very well is running Condor as non-root,
because of the task_for_pid() change to the Mach kernel. Because of the
new tfp policy settings, we can't track processes unless Condor is
root or a member of the procview group - even if they're the same uid.
This is disappointing, and we're not sure what we're going to do yet.
